As far as rust and Kentucky, it will have plenty if it has been here a while. If it was truly a CA car most of its life and was recently transplanted here it should be fine.
But you never truly know until you cut it open

What they said on Sasquatch. Fun on the little track, not so fun on the street. Rock hard, squeeky urethane bushings, loud motor w/o 350 power. Still fun and solid. Depends what you want and are looking for.
